We are Reach because it's what we do.

Every day our newsbrands - national and regional, in print and online - reach millions of people up and down the country. We are the UK's largest news publisher, with influential national newsbrands such as the Daily Mirror, Daily Express, Sunday People, Daily Record, and more than 100 distinguished regional titles.

Our brands have a long heritage of being trusted sources of news and information, with our editorial conviction and high standards of journalism providing audiences with timely information and opinion across multiple platforms.

Last year we sold 540 million newspapers, and our network of over 70 websites provide 24/7 coverage of news, sport and showbiz stories, viewed by 110m unique browsers every month.
